How Long Can You Expect Your iPhone’s Battery to Last on Average?

On average, an iPhone battery retains 80% capacity after 500 full charge cycles, lasting 2-3 years with daily use. Lifespan depends on usage patterns, temperature exposure, charging habits, and iOS updates. Apple recommends battery replacement when capacity drops below 80% to maintain performance. Factors like gaming, streaming, and background apps accelerate degradation.

What Factors Influence iPhone Battery Lifespan?

Key factors include charge cycles (1 cycle = 0-100% depletion), extreme temperatures (above 95°F/35°C or below 32°F/0°C), fast charging habits, and app energy consumption. Heavy users draining 100% daily may need replacements in 18 months, while light users often exceed 3 years. Lithium-ion chemistry naturally degrades 2-3% monthly even during non-use.

Recent studies reveal that frequent partial charging (20-80% range) can extend cycle count by 50% compared to full discharges. High-resolution gaming sessions generate 8-10W thermal loads, accelerating chemical breakdown. Environmental factors play a crucial role – devices left in cars during summer months experience accelerated capacity loss of up to 4% per week. Apple’s power management ICs help mitigate damage by regulating voltage spikes during fast charging.

How Can You Check Your iPhone’s Battery Health?

Navigate to Settings > Battery > Battery Health to view maximum capacity and peak performance capability. Third-party apps like CoconutBattery or iMazing provide detailed cycle counts. Apple Stores run diagnostics testing voltage stability and impedance. Below 80% capacity triggers “Service Recommended” warnings, though functionality continues with potential throttling via iOS performance management systems.

Which Charging Practices Extend Battery Longevity?

Optimal practices include maintaining 20-80% charge, using Apple-certified 20W chargers, avoiding overnight charging, and disabling “Optimized Battery Charging” during irregular usage. Wireless charging generates more heat, accelerating degradation by up to 15% compared to wired. For storage, keep at 50% charge in cool environments. Battery University research shows partial discharges reduce stress versus full cycles.

When Should You Consider Battery Replacement?

Replace when experiencing sudden shutdowns, swollen batteries, or charging times exceeding 3 hours. Apple’s $89-$99 service includes genuine parts and 90-day warranty. Third-party replacements cost $40-$70 but may lack temperature sensors or iOS compatibility. Post-replacement, recalibrate through full discharge/recharge cycles. New batteries typically restore original runtime but degrade faster if previous poor habits continue.

How Do iOS Updates Impact Battery Performance?

Major iOS versions often include power management algorithms that may temporarily reduce runtime as systems reindex data. Background processes like Photos facial recognition consume extra power for 24-48 hours post-update. Controversial “Performance Management” mode activates automatically on degraded batteries, capping CPU speeds by up to 40% to prevent crashes. Disable this via Battery Health settings but expect instability.

Recent iOS 17 updates introduced adaptive thermal management that dynamically adjusts performance based on real-time temperature sensors. Users report 15-20% better standby times after major updates, though initial installation may cause 2-3 days of abnormal drain. The “Background App Refresh” feature remains a silent battery killer, consuming up to 25% of daily power in devices with poor signal strength.

Are Certain iPhone Models Prone to Faster Drain?

iPhone 6/6s (1810mAh) and iPhone 12 mini (2227mAh) have the shortest longevity due to small capacities. The iPhone 14 Pro Max (4323mAh) lasts longest. OLED displays (iPhone X onward) save 15% power versus LCD. 5G models experience 20% faster drain than 4G counterparts when cellular signal is weak. ProMotion displays dynamically adjust 10-120Hz refresh rates to conserve energy.

Conclusion

iPhone batteries are consumables designed for 2-3 years of optimal service. Through mindful charging, temperature control, and health monitoring, users can extend lifespan up to 4 years. Recognize warning signs like rapid discharge or swelling, and prioritize Apple-certified replacements. Remember: battery longevity is a marathon, not a sprint—small daily habits compound into significant lifespan differences.

FAQs

Does Dark Mode Save Battery?
On OLED iPhones (X and newer), dark mode reduces display power by up to 60% during low-light use. LCD models see minimal savings. Enable via Settings > Display & Brightness.
Can You Replace iPhone Batteries Yourself?
Possible with kits ($20-$50), but risks include breaking Face ID sensors (iPhone X onward) or water seal damage. Apple warns DIY repairs may trigger “Unknown Part” warnings in iOS 15.4+.
Do Battery Cases Help Longevity?
Yes. By keeping internal battery at 100% while draining the case first, they reduce cycle counts. Apple’s Smart Battery Case includes optimized charging circuits. Third-party cases may lack temperature regulation.
